Mac client (ldap) commands

Note
The commands in this section relate to the ldap database.
The ldap database is used for logging onto a Mac client
connected to the HDXchange domain.
To view the ldap entries, type the command:
ldapsearch -x -b 'dc=hdxchange, dc=com' | less
Manually adding Mac users to ldap
database
Command: sudo /opt/dvstation/www/html/webadmin/
users/addldapuser.sh
Options: None
Description: This command is used to manually add an
HDXchange user to the ldap database. This command can
be used when a user that has been added to HDXchange
via webadmin, has failed to update the ldap database.
Manually deleting Mac users from ldap
database
Command: sudo /opt/dvstation/www/html/webadmin/
users/deleteldapuser.sh
Options: None
Description: This command is used to manually delete a
HDXchange user from the ldap database. This command
can be used when a user that has been deleted from
HDXchange via webadmin, has failed to update the ldap
database.
Manually adding groups to ldap database
Command: sudo /opt/dvstation/www/html/webadmin/
groups/addldapgroup.sh
Options: None
Description: This command is used to manually add an
HDXchange group to the ldap database. This command
can be used when a group that has been added to
HDXchange via webadmin, has failed to update the ldap
database.
Manually deleting groups from ldap
database
Command: sudo /opt/dvstation/www/html/webadmin/
groups/deleteldapgroup.sh

Options: None
Description: This command is used to manually delete an
HDXchange group from the ldap database. This command
can be used when a user that has been deleted from
HDXchange via webadmin, has failed to update the ldap
database.

Miscellaneous commands

Rebuilding the OS RAID
Command: sudo /opt/dvstation/www/html/webadmin/
cgi-bin/webadmin/rebuildsoftraid.pl
Options: None
Description: This command is used to start the rebuild of
the OS software RAID.
Listing Bins and directories
Command: sudo /bin/ls
Options: None
Description: This command is used to list the contents of a
specified directory.
Deleting files
Command: sudo /bin/rm
Options: None
Description: This command allows the deletion of files
from HDXchange. Please use with great care.
Network settings
Command: sudo /sbin/ifconfig
Options: None
Description: This command displays the network settings
of the NIC card such as IP address, subnet mask etc.
Samba service
Command: sudo /etc/init.d/smb
Options: start, stop, restart, status
Description: This command may be used with the above
listed options. The samba service is used to allow a client
PC access the HDXchange server.
